NEW BOOK: Racism's Knowledge: Disciplines, Decolonisation, and the Renewal of the Academy
We are excited to announce the publication of Racism's Knowledge: Disciplines, Decolonisation and the Renewal of the Academy (2026), edited by Prof André Keet (Nelson Mandela University) and Prof Shirley Anne Tate (University of Alberta). A collection of new and previously published work, the book opens with a provocation that runs through every chapter: What if racism does not merely infiltrate knowledge but owns it?
